Through Public Allies Arizona , I was placed at AZCEND as the Family Resource Center Coordinator. AZCEND offers food boxes through their Food Bank, rent and utility assistance though the Community Action Program (CAP), and senior programs through the Chandler Senior Center and the Gilbert Community Center.
